"Indian Flute" is an iconic hip-hop track by the legendary producer Timbaland and his longtime partner Magoo, released in November 2003 as a single from their album Under Construction, Part II. The song is widely recognized for its hypnotic melody and its role in the early 2000s trend of incorporating "Eastern" sounds into mainstream American hip-hop and R&B.
